What Happened
Cobre Panamá organized community cleaning days in Donoso and La Pintada while promoting new employment opportunities, the company said. The activities were carried out in conjunction with local authorities and included outreach related to hiring, according to the announcement published March 19, 2026.
Details from the Company
The company said residents participating in the events expressed gratitude for the opportunities being offered. A manager at Cobre Panamá commented that these initiatives reflect the company’s commitment, as noted in the company release. The announcement linked the community cleanup efforts with broader hiring promotion but did not provide further specifics about job numbers or roles.
